The Hickam AFB Medical Facility, officially known as the 15th Medical Group, is located at 755 Scott Circle (Bldg  559), Hickam AFB, HI. It operates as an outpatient clinic for active-duty members and their families.

 

 

Responsibilities

As a Mental Health Consultant at Hickam AFB, you will serve as a critical subject matter expert, bridging the gap between direct clinical care and command-level health strategies.

 

 

Patient Care & Documentation:

  • Conduct brief, targeted biopsychosocial assessments.
  • Deliver evidence-based interventions in 30-minute appointments using a stepped-care model.
  • Treat chronic conditions, insomnia, acute stress, and health behaviors.
  • Triage/refer complex cases to Specialty Mental Health.
  • Complete concise electronic medical record documentation within 72 hours of the visit.

 

Consultation & Team-Based Care:

  • Provide immediate, succinct feedback to Primary Care Managers (PCMs).
  • Actively drive same-day "warm handoffs" and increase clinic-wide service penetration.
  • Review daily PCM schedules ("scrubbing lists") and participate in morning huddles.
  • Offer continuity consultation to monitor long-term patients and prevent relapse.

 

 Educational Activities :

  • Develop and lead educational classes focused on coping skills and behavior change.
  • Train primary care clinic staff to recognize symptoms and optimize PCMHI referral pathways.

Qualifications

U.S. Citizenship required.

 

Master of Social Work (MSW) from a CSWE-accredited institution.

 

Active, unrestricted Clinical Social Work License (e.g., LCSW, LICSW) permitting independent practice from any U.S. jurisdiction.
